Target B3GNT4
Full Name UDP-GlcNAc:BetaGal Beta-1,3-O-acetylglucosaminyltransferase 4
Alternative Name B3GN-T4, beta3Gn-T4
Location 12q24.31
Gene ID 79369
Summary Involved in the biosynthesis of poly-N-acetyllactosamine chains, utilizing lacto-N-neotetraose as a preferred substrate.
